  • Patent number: 5820010
    Abstract: A flywheel device for use in a magnetic recording/reproducing unit or the like which device is simple in construction, and can be produced at low costs, and a method of making it. A capstan shaft is press-fitted in a hole formed in a central portion of a metal disk, and then a resin is filled on an outer peripheral portion and a central portion of the disk by outsert molding to form an outer peripheral resin portion and a central resin portion. The outer peripheral resin portion has a groove formed in an outer periphery thereof, and the central resin portion has gear portions.

  • Patent number: 5737036
    Abstract: A color image display apparatus utilizing a field sequential signal displays a picture normally without disturbance or deteriorating vertical resolution even when displaying an interlace image signal. The color image display apparatus is formed by a field sequential signal generator for converting a primary color signal to be interlaced into a field sequential signal, a monochrome image display apparatus for sequentially displaying a converted field sequential signal, a color apparatus 5 disposed to face a display screen of the monochrome image display apparatus to color a field sequential signal displayed on the display screen, and a control circuit for controlling timing of operations of these elements. A field judging result is supplied to the control circuit, and the control circuit operates so that a horizontal synchronizing signal of the field sequential signal is outputted continuously in a constant cycle even when an image signal to be interlaced is inputted.
